Understanding Plumbing Camera Inspections
A plumbing camera inspection, sometimes referred to as a drain line camera inspection or sewer scope, is a non-invasive diagnostic technique used by skilled plumbers to visually inspect the interior of your sewer lines and other drain pipes. This advanced method allows professionals to pinpoint the exact location and nature of obstructions, cracks, breaks, or other damage within your underground or inaccessible plumbing infrastructure.
This process is particularly beneficial in older neighborhoods like Center City, Philadelphia, where tree root intrusion, pipe corrosion, or collapsed sections can silently wreak havoc beneath your property. Foregoing regular inspections could lead to costly emergency repairs and significant water damage.
How a Camera Inspection Works
The process is straightforward yet highly effective. A qualified plumber will typically perform the following steps:
- A drain or sewer line is accessed, often through a cleanout point.
- A specialized, flexible video camera attached to a long cable is carefully inserted into the pipe.
- The cable is fed into the pipe, allowing the camera to transmit real-time video footage to a monitor.
- The plumber meticulously examines the video feed, looking for any anomalies.
- The camera is equipped with a transmitter that allows the plumber to precisely locate any identified problems from above ground.
This technology utilizes robust, waterproof cameras designed to navigate the intricacies of plumbing systems, even in tight bends and turns. The high-definition video output provides clear imagery, enabling accurate diagnosis.

Early Detection of Problems
One of the most significant benefits is the ability to detect minor issues before they escalate into major emergencies. Small cracks, hairline fractures, or early signs of root intrusion can be identified and addressed proactively, saving you from potentially catastrophic pipe failures and expensive water damage, which can be a particular concern in the diverse range of homes found throughout Center City, from historic brownstones to modern apartments.
Accurate Diagnosis and Resolution
Instead of guessing the cause of recurring clogs or slow drains, a camera inspection provides a definitive visual diagnosis. This accuracy ensures that plumbers can implement the most effective and targeted repair strategy, avoiding unnecessary work and expense.
Preventative Maintenance
Regular inspections serve as a crucial part of preventative maintenance. By identifying potential weak points in your system, you can schedule repairs during a time that is convenient for you, rather than dealing with an unexpected crisis. This peace of mind is especially valuable for property owners in busy urban settings.
Assessing Property Purchases
When considering a property purchase in areas like Washington Square West or Fitler Square, a camera inspection of the sewer lines is highly recommended. It can reveal hidden problems that might not be apparent during a standard home inspection, preventing costly surprises down the line.

How long does a typical plumbing camera inspection take in Center City?
The duration of a plumbing camera inspection can vary depending on the complexity of your plumbing system and the extent of the investigation. However, for a standard inspection of main sewer lines or a few drainpipes in a typical Center City home, you can generally expect it to take between 1 to 2 hours. Factors like the length of the pipe being inspected, the number of access points, and the severity of any identified issue can influence the overall time.
What types of plumbing issues can a camera inspection detect in older Center City buildings?
Camera inspections are exceptionally effective at detecting a wide range of issues common in older Center City buildings with established infrastructure. This includes, but is not limited to:
- Tree root intrusion into pipes
- Bellied or sagging pipes
- Cracked or broken pipes
- Collapsed pipe sections
- Foreign object obstructions
- Corrosion and scaling
- Improper pipe slope
- Bellied joints
